About the Role - Tier 1/2
As a Tier 1/2 Technical Support Specialist, you'll be on the front line of our service team. You'll troubleshoot issues, provide remote support, deploy solutions, escalate when needed, and ensure every client interaction reflects our values.
You will work closely with our Operations Manager, senior technicians, and onboarding teams to deliver a best-in-class client experience.
This role has clear advancement pathways into Tier 3, Network Analyst, Cybersecurity, or Project roles for the right individual.
What You'll Do
Technical Support & Troubleshooting
- Respond to support tickets, calls, and emails in a timely manner
- Diagnose and resolve issues involving:
- Windows OS
- Microsoft 365
- Networking basics (DNS, DHCP, VPN, Wi-Fi)
- Hardware/peripherals
- Printers & shared drives
- Line-of-business applications
- Escalate complex issues to Tier 3 when necessary

Tier 3 Technician / Senior Systems Engineer
As a Tier 3 Technician, you will be the escalation point for complex technical issues and the leader on advanced implementations. You will work closely with our Operations Manager and Tier 1/2 team to ensure high-level resolution, excellent documentation, and strong technical standards across our service stack.
This role is ideal for someone who enjoys:
- Leading major projects
- Designing solutions
- Working directly with clients
- Mentoring junior technicians
- Owning environments end-to-end
What You'll Do
Tier 3 Escalations
- Resolve complex issues involving servers, networking, virtualization, security, cloud infrastructure, and integrations
- Provide deep technical troubleshooting and root-cause analysis
- Support escalation requests from Tier 1 and Tier 2 technicians
Implementation & Projects
- Lead or support major implementations, including:
- Server deployments & migrations
- Network redesigns
- Firewall and security stack deployments
- Microsoft 365 & Azure projects
- Backup/disaster recovery implementations
- Cybersecurity upgrades
- Ensure all projects follow Willcraft's documentation and scope processes

Essential Technical Requirements
Candidates should be confident with most of the following:
Core Infrastructure
- Windows Server (2012–2022)
- Active Directory & Group Policy
- Azure AD / Entra ID
- Intune device management
Networking
- Firewalls (Fortinet, SonicWall, WatchGuard, or similar)
- VLANs, routing, VPNs
- Wi-Fi systems & switching fundamentals
Cloud & Productivity Tools
- Microsoft 365 administration
- Azure infrastructure experience (VMs, storage, security)
- SharePoint, OneDrive, Teams troubleshooting
Security
- MFA, conditional access
- Endpoint security tools
- Patch management
- Backup & disaster recovery systems
Tools
- Experience with PSA/RMM platforms
- Documentation platforms such as IT Glue
- Ticketing system best practices
